Samsung plans to unveil its new media player at the CES, next year. It has already released a video of Galaxy Player 50, which belongs to the family of Galaxy S and Galaxy Tab.
Galaxy Player

Samsung is getting ready to compete with iPod Touch, with Galaxy Player, which will run  Android 2.2 Froyo operating system. According to Samsung Hub it will come in 8, 16 and 32 GB models. Features like SoundAlive audio enhancement technology, HD video playback, Wi-Fi and Bluetooth 3.0 are included in this media player.

Galaxy Player has a 4-inch Super Clear LCD touchscreen with WVGA resolution and it is 9.9 mm thick. For video chatting, it has a dual facing camera with 3.2 megapixel camera on the back and 1.3 megapixel camera on the front. It also has a microSD card slot and the users can access Android Market.

When compared to iPod Touch’s 960 x 640-pixel “retina display”, Galaxy Player falls short with 800 x 480-pixel display. But it supports all Google apps like Gmail, Google Maps, You Tube etc., At present there are no media players running Android.

No information is available about the pricing of Galaxy Player.
